Beware of the illegal market for pets. When caring for a macaw, it is essential to provide them an extensive diet to ensure they are healthy. A variety of fruits and vegetables as well as whole grains must be part of their diet. It is recommended to give them fresh clean water at all times. In their cage, a clean water bowl should be placed. The bowl should be changed every day to stop the growth of bacterial. It is also important to cut your Macaw's nails on a regular basis. This will help keep them from getting entangled in objects and clogging. Maintaining the trim of your bird's nails will help in the process of caring for and handling them easier. It's also a good idea to offer a variety of toys and activities for your pet, since they can be very bored when they are left alone. This can lead to unhealthy behaviors, such as feather destruction and biting. A bird that is fed a balanced, healthy diet will have an immune system that is strong and good overall health. It is recommended to have your bird undergo an annual exam to an exotic veterinarian. These examinations should include a fecal examination and blood tests. It is also a good idea to get your bird tested for Polyoma and Psittacosis, as these are two common diseases that affect birds. You should also find an expert in avian care in your region. These vets are often more knowledgeable about the particular requirements of a parrot and will provide the best possible care. They might also be able to recommend a different specialist if your pet has special requirements. Feeding Macaws are large birds that consume a lot of food and must be fed a diet that is high in protein and fat. The best choice is to feed them an enriched bird food that is specially formulated for macaws. You can purchase these bird foods from several pet stores and online. These meals are typically high in minerals and vitamins that your bird requires. It is also recommended to provide them with fresh fruits and vegetables that have been cleaned thoroughly to remove pesticides as well as other chemicals. Some of the most nutritious fruits and veggies for these birds include romaine lettuce and carrots squash, zucchini, and green beans. It is also recommended to give them an assortment of fruit and nuts, as well as melons, bananas, and apples. In the wild, macaws consume a variety of nuts and seeds to ensure they have a balanced diet. It's not a good idea for a macaw to consume only these foods. This type of diet can cause a myriad of health issues as well as a short life span for the bird. If you have a macaw that's eating a diet based on seeds it's necessary to work with it to change to a healthier one. It could take a few weeks, months or even days to let the macaw learn to eat a new diet.
